Precious Metal Coming To An End

Precious Metal, a series of live shows held at Lit Lounge in New York City, will come to an end on January 21st, 2013, after 6.66 years and over 300 events.

Created in 2006 by Curran Reynolds, a music publicist and drummer for bands such as Today Is The Day, Precious Metal showcased a diverse array of bands from around the city and as far away as Iceland, Italy, Iraq, and Australia. Precious Metal was named "NYC's best metal party" by The Village Voice, "the city's most open-minded metal night" by Time Out New York, "the best in contemporary extreme metal" by The A.V. Club, and "Manhattan's epicenter of underground metal" by Invisible Oranges.

The series will end with a benefit show to raise money for The South Sound, a Brooklyn music space destroyed by Hurricane Sandy. Curran Reynolds issued the following statement:

“Friends, I am proud to announce the Grand Finale of Precious Metal. After 6.66 years and over 300 events, the series I started in May of 2006 will come to an end on January 21, 2013. We had a good run! Monday after Monday, we brought all sorts of heaviness into the den of Downtown grime and glamour that is Lit. These forces combined and added up to something special. I like to think we played a part in the resurgence of a New York City metal scene, one which now looks stronger than ever.”

BrooklynVegan’s Fred Pessaro adds: “I can't tell you how many great bands I have seen over the years at Precious Metal. The series is responsible not only for the first appearances from some favorite bands but also many personal friendships forged in that dingy basement.”

I Am Heresy Posts Album/Tour Trailer

I Am Heresy has a new self-titled album due out in Europe on February 22nd, 2013 through End Hits Records. The band has now released a teaser clip for the album and upcoming live shows, which can be seen below. I Am Heresy also commented:

"Here is the latest promo/teaser video for our album's European release/European tour!! the song snippet is called 'Pigs In Seizure,' and is the bonus track for the album."

I Am Heresy Announces Lineup Changes

U.S. act I Am Heresy has checked in with the following announcement about parting ways with two members:

"OK... here's the deal...Simon Gray and Jonah Latshaw have decided to part ways with I Am Heresy in order to put more time into their band The May 4TH Massacre.

"This show will be their last show before moving on, so come out and say goodbye and good luck! Also, please welcome Eros Iuliano and Matt Balog to the fold....word!"

I Am Heresy To Record Debut Album

Magic Bullet Records has issued the following announcement about I Am Heresy entering the studio to record the band's debut album:

"As we continue to celebrate the 15th year of Magic Bullet Records, it’s time to reveal another awesome twist.

"As many in the listening audience will recall, the first ever record released on the label was Boy Set Fire‘s 'This Crying, This Screaming, My Voice is Being Born' back in 1997. Fast forward to 2012 and BSF singer Nathan Gray has brought his new band into the fold; a six-headed monster of sound that has been christened I Am Heresy. More...

I Am Heresy Streaming Demo Online

U.S. act I Am Heresy has posted a two song demo online, which can be streamed or downloaded through the player below. The band also commented on its history:

"What happens when your band falls apart and everything you worked toward is abruptly thrown away? You start a new one! That is exactly what Nathan Gray (Boysetsfire, Casting Out) decided to do once his last musical effort The Casting Out ceased to exist. Not one to sit around and cry about the situation, he decided to move forward and form something completely new.

"He didn't have to look far though, realizing that his son Simon Gray and fellow band mate Jonah Latshaw (May 4th Massacre) both were very talented musicians in their own right, he recruited them to start a new band. Going back to the roots of what made Boysetsfire such a powerful force in the punk/hardcore scene, mixed in with the younger metal influence of Simon and Jonah..... I AM HERESY was formed.

"To help complete the band and take it to the next level, brothers Jay and Crumbs Konieko (The Dead and Gone) were added on Bass and Drums respectively. The last piece to the puzzle to help reinforce such and imposing sound was former (Chambers) guitarist Gregg Kautz. As a whole each band member brings their own unique musical style to form an imposing wall of sound that has and will continue to grow and evolve. I AM HERESY." More...
